The Technical Specifications of the Mitsubishi ASX Car Key
The Mitsubishi ASX key fob is a technically sophisticated element that enhances both security and benefit. Below are the technical specs of the ASX car key:
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Key Fob Dimensions | Approx. 3.5 x 1.5 x 0.5 inches |
| Battery Type | CR2032 lithium battery |
| Operating Frequency | 433 MHz or 315 MHz, depending on the region |
| Setting Method | Requires special devices for programming extra keys |
| Range | As much as 30 meters (100 feet) in ideal conditions |

Changing the Mitsubishi ASX Car Key
When it comes to replacing a Mitsubishi Asx Key Replacement ASX car key, car owners have numerous choices:
1. Authorized Mitsubishi Dealership
| Pros | Cons |
|---|---|
| – Expertise in programming and cutting keys | – Generally more costly |
| – Original equipment quality (OEQ) | – Longer wait times |
| – Access to producer service warranty and support |
2. Licensed Automotive Locksmith
| Pros | Cons |
|---|---|
| – Usually less expensive than dealerships | – Skill levels might differ |
| – Can frequently offer quicker service | – May not have access to all key types |
| – Convenience of mobile service |
3. Online Retailers
| Pros | Cons |
|---|---|
| – Competitive prices | – Requires self-programming understanding |
| – Various options offered | – Risk of getting inaccurate or low-quality items |

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Can I use any Mitsubishi key for my ASX?
No, you should use a key particularly developed for your Mitsubishi Fast Key ASX model to ensure compatibility with the ignition system.
2. How long does a key fob battery normally last?
A key fob battery typically lasts in between 1-3 years, depending upon use.
3. What should I do if my key fob quits working?
Start by checking the battery and changing it if necessary. If the issue continues, consult a dealer or locksmith for more diagnosis.
4. Is it possible to program a brand-new key myself?
Yes, some online resources might offer directions, but it typically needs specialized devices. It is advisable to speak with a professional.
